* [PATCH v2 2/4] ARM: dts: aspeed: santabarbara: Enable MCTP for frontend NIC
  2025-08-14 13:16 [PATCH v2 0/4] Revise Meta Santabarbara devicetree Fred Chen
  2025-08-14 13:16 ` [PATCH v2 1/4] ARM: dts: aspeed: santabarbara: add sensor support for extension boards Fred Chen
@ 2025-08-14 13:16 ` Fred Chen
  2025-08-14 13:16 ` [PATCH v2 3/4] ARM: dts: aspeed: santabarbara: Adjust LED configuration Fred Chen
                   ` (2 subsequent siblings)
  4 siblings, 0 replies; 7+ messages in thread
From: Fred Chen @ 2025-08-14 13:16 UTC (permalink / raw)
  To: Rob Herring, Krzysztof Kozlowski, Conor Dooley, Joel Stanley,
	Andrew Jeffery, devicetree, linux-arm-kernel, linux-aspeed,
	linux-kernel

Add the mctp-controller property and MCTP node to enable frontend NIC
management via PLDM over MCTP.

Signed-off-by: Fred Chen <fredchen.openbmc@gmail.com>
---
 .../bo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ts  | 8 ++++++++
 1 file changed, 8 insertions(+)

diff --git a/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ts b/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ts
index 2f5712e9ba9f..ed30f3bf61a4 100644
--- a/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ts
+++ b/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ts
@@ -1248,8 +1248,16 @@ temperature-sensor@49 {
 };
 
 &i2c11 {
+	multi-master;
+	mctp-controller;
 	status = "okay";
 
+	mctp@10 {
+		compatible = "mctp-i2c-controller";
+		reg = <(0x10 | I2C_OWN_SLAVE_ADDRESS)>;
+		label = "mb_nic0_mctp";
+	};
+
 	// OCP NIC TEMP
 	temperature-sensor@1f {
 		compatible = "ti,tmp421";
-- 
2.49.0


^ permalink raw reply related	[flat|nested] 7+ messages in thread

* [PATCH v2 3/4] ARM: dts: aspeed: santabarbara: Adjust LED configuration
  2025-08-14 13:16 [PATCH v2 0/4] Revise Meta Santabarbara devicetree Fred Chen
  2025-08-14 13:16 ` [PATCH v2 1/4] ARM: dts: aspeed: santabarbara: add sensor support for extension boards Fred Chen
  2025-08-14 13:16 ` [PATCH v2 2/4] ARM: dts: aspeed: santabarbara: Enable MCTP for frontend NIC Fred Chen
@ 2025-08-14 13:16 ` Fred Chen
  2025-08-14 13:17 ` [PATCH v2 4/4] ARM: dts: aspeed: santabarbara: add sgpio line name for leak detection Fred Chen
  2025-08-15 21:19 ` [PATCH v2 0/4] Revise Meta Santabarbara devicetree Rob Herring (Arm)
  4 siblings, 0 replies; 7+ messages in thread
From: Fred Chen @ 2025-08-14 13:16 UTC (permalink / raw)
  To: Rob Herring, Krzysztof Kozlowski, Conor Dooley, Joel Stanley,
	Andrew Jeffery, devicetree, linux-arm-kernel, linux-aspeed,
	linux-kernel

Update LED definitions to match changes in the hardware spec. Add a
power-fault LED on GPIOB5 and relocate the ID LED to GPIOQ4 via the
CPLD. The ID LED now shares the power LED: it blinks when ID is active
and otherwise indicates power state with logic controlled by the CPLD.
Retain the 'fp_id_amber' label so /sys/class/leds/fp_id_amber remains
valid for existing users.

Add a 'bmc_ready_noled' LED on GPIOB3 with GPIO_TRANSITORY to ensure its
state resets on BMC reboot.

Signed-off-by: Fred Chen <fredchen.openbmc@gmail.com>
---
 .../dts/aspeed/aspeed-bmc-facebook-santabarbara.dts | 13 ++++++++++++-
 1 file changed, 12 insertions(+), 1 deletion(-)

diff --git a/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ts b/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ts
index ed30f3bf61a4..ed2432f37609 100644
--- a/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ts
+++ b/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ts
@@ -94,7 +94,7 @@ led-0 {
 		};
 
 		led-1 {
-			label = "fp_id_amber";
+			label = "power_fault";
 			default-state = "off";
 			gpios = <&gpio0 ASPEED_GPIO(B, 5) GPIO_ACTIVE_HIGH>;
 		};
@@ -104,6 +104,17 @@ led-2 {
 			default-state = "off";
 			gpios = <&gpio0 ASPEED_GPIO(P, 4) GPIO_ACTIVE_HIGH>;
 		};
+
+		led-3 {
+			label = "fp_id_amber";
+			default-state = "off";
+			gpios = <&gpio0 ASPEED_GPIO(Q, 4) GPIO_ACTIVE_HIGH>;
+		};
+
+		led-4 {
+			label = "bmc_ready_noled";
+			gpios = <&gpio0 ASPEED_GPIO(B, 3) (GPIO_ACTIVE_HIGH|GPIO_TRANSITORY)>;
+		};
 	};
 
 	memory@80000000 {
-- 
2.49.0


^ permalink raw reply related	[flat|nested] 7+ messages in thread

* [PATCH v2 4/4] ARM: dts: aspeed: santabarbara: add sgpio line name for leak detection
  2025-08-14 13:16 [PATCH v2 0/4] Revise Meta Santabarbara devicetree Fred Chen
                   ` (2 preceding siblings ...)
  2025-08-14 13:16 ` [PATCH v2 3/4] ARM: dts: aspeed: santabarbara: Adjust LED configuration Fred Chen
@ 2025-08-14 13:17 ` Fred Chen
  2025-08-15 21:19 ` [PATCH v2 0/4] Revise Meta Santabarbara devicetree Rob Herring (Arm)
  4 siblings, 0 replies; 7+ messages in thread
From: Fred Chen @ 2025-08-14 13:17 UTC (permalink / raw)
  To: Rob Herring, Krzysztof Kozlowski, Conor Dooley, Joel Stanley,
	Andrew Jeffery, devicetree, linux-arm-kernel, linux-aspeed,
	linux-kernel

Add leak-related line names for the SGPIO inputs that report chassis
leaks, so userspace can detect and handle leak events

Signed-off-by: Fred Chen <fredchen.openbmc@gmail.com>
---
 .../dts/aspeed/aspeed-bmc-facebook-santabarbara.dts  | 12 +++++++++---
 1 file changed, 9 insertions(+), 3 deletions(-)

diff --git a/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ts b/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ts
index ed2432f37609..6af8b22f72e1 100644
--- a/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ts
+++ b/arch/arm/boot/dts/aspeed/aspeed-bmc-facebook-santabarbara.dts
@@ -1767,11 +1767,17 @@ &sgpiom0 {
 	"PRSNT_LEAK_CABLE_1_R_N","",
 	"PRSNT_LEAK_CABLE_2_R_N","",
 	"PRSNT_HDT_N","",
-	"","",
+	"LEAK_SWB_COLDPLATE","",
 	/*P0-P3 line 240-247*/
-	"","","","","","","","",
+	"LEAK_R3_COLDPLATE","",
+	"LEAK_R2_COLDPLATE","",
+	"LEAK_R1_COLDPLATE","",
+	"LEAK_R0_COLDPLATE","",
 	/*P4-P7 line 248-255*/
-	"","","","","","","","";
+	"LEAK_MB_COLDPLATE","",
+	"LEAK_PDB1_RIGHT_MANIFOLD","",
+	"LEAK_PDB1_LEFT_MANIFOLD","",
+	"LEAK_MB_MANIFOLD","";
 	status = "okay";
 };
 
-- 
2.49.0


^ permalink raw reply related	[flat|nested] 7+ messages in thread
